What is the Parameter E in the G-code of Repsnapper?

It's the mm of filament the extruder extrudes, either per command ("relative E-code") or cumulative

E codes are used during Printing progress

It denotes how much length of PLA or ABS to be extruded during Printing

Initially E codes are set to E0
E1.0000 denotes extrusion of 1mm PLA/ABS

if you need to extrude 1mm more then E code should be E2.0000

i.e., incrementing the values whenever you need the extrusion

if the next value is E1.5000 the extruder sucks back the PLA about 0.5mm

You can vary the Extrusion Multiplier in Printer settings and convert to Gcode to increment or decrement the Extrusion length in percentile during printing (It works during printing)
